怎么把Excel变为PPT

怎么把Excel变为PPT

将Excel变为PPT的方法有多种,主要包括直接复制粘贴、使用链接、导出为图片、使用Excel内置功能等。本文将详细介绍这些方法,并提供专业见解和实用技巧。

一、直接复制粘贴

直接复制粘贴是将Excel内容转移到PPT中的最简单方法。这种方法适用于较小数据量的Excel表格,并且不需要保持数据的动态更新。

1. 选择和复制Excel内容

打开Excel文件并选择需要复制的内容。可以选择单个单元格、多个单元格、整个表格或特定区域。按下Ctrl+C复制选中的内容。

2. 粘贴到PPT

打开PPT文件,并导航到需要粘贴内容的幻灯片。在PPT中,右键点击选择“粘贴选项”,可以选择“保持源格式”、“匹配目标格式”或“图片”。选择适当的粘贴选项,根据需要调整格式。

二、使用链接

使用链接可以将Excel中的数据动态链接到PPT中。这种方法适用于需要保持数据实时更新的情况。

1. 复制Excel内容并创建链接

在Excel中选择需要复制的内容,按下Ctrl+C。在PPT中,选择要粘贴的幻灯片,右键点击选择“粘贴选项”,然后选择“链接和保留格式”或“链接并匹配目标格式”。

2. 更新链接

当Excel数据发生变化时,PPT中的链接数据会自动更新。可以通过右键点击PPT中的链接内容,选择“更新链接”来手动更新数据。

三、导出为图片

将Excel内容导出为图片,然后插入到PPT中。这种方法适用于需要保持数据格式和样式的情况。

1. 将Excel内容导出为图片

在Excel中选择需要导出的内容,按下Alt+Print Screen截取屏幕截图,或者使用Excel内置的“保存为图片”功能(文件->另存为->选择图片格式)。

2. 插入图片到PPT

打开PPT文件,选择需要插入图片的幻灯片,点击“插入”->“图片”,选择刚才保存的图片文件,点击“插入”。根据需要调整图片大小和位置。

四、使用Excel内置功能

Excel和PPT都提供了一些内置功能,可以方便地将Excel内容转移到PPT中。

1. 使用Excel中的“发送至PPT”功能

在Excel中,选择需要发送到PPT的内容,点击“文件”->“发送至”->“Microsoft PowerPoint”。Excel会自动将选中的内容插入到新建的PPT幻灯片中。

2. 使用PPT的“插入对象”功能

在PPT中,选择需要插入Excel内容的幻灯片,点击“插入”->“对象”->“由文件创建”,选择Excel文件。这样可以将整个Excel文件插入到PPT中,并可以双击打开进行编辑。

五、利用Excel和PPT宏

利用宏可以自动化将Excel内容转移到PPT中的过程,适用于需要定期更新大量数据的情况。

1. 创建Excel宏

在Excel中,按下Alt+F11打开VBA编辑器,创建一个新的宏,编写代码将选中的内容复制并粘贴到PPT中。

Sub ExportToPPT()

Dim pptApp As Object

Dim pptPres As Object

Dim pptSlide As Object

Dim xlSheet As Worksheet

' Create a new PowerPoint application

Set pptApp = CreateObject("PowerPoint.Application")

pptApp.Visible = True

Set pptPres = pptApp.Presentations.Add

' Reference the active sheet

Set xlSheet = ActiveSheet

' Copy the used range in Excel

xlSheet.UsedRange.Copy

' Add a new slide to the presentation

Set pptSlide = pptPres.Slides.Add(1, 11) ' 11 is ppLayoutText

' Paste the copied range into the slide

pptSlide.Shapes.PasteSpecial DataType:=2 ' 2 is ppPasteEnhancedMetafile

' Clean up

Set pptSlide = Nothing

Set pptPres = Nothing

Set pptApp = Nothing

End Sub

2. 运行宏

在Excel中,按下Alt+F8打开宏对话框,选择刚才创建的宏并点击“运行”。宏会自动将Excel内容复制并粘贴到新的PPT幻灯片中。

六、使用第三方工具

市面上有很多第三方工具可以将Excel内容转换为PPT。这些工具通常提供更多功能和更好的用户体验。

1. Aspose.Cells for .NET

Aspose.Cells for .NET是一个强大的Excel处理库,可以将Excel文件导出为PPT格式。使用这个库,可以方便地将Excel内容转换为PPT,并保持数据格式和样式。

// Load the Excel file

Workbook workbook = new Workbook("input.xlsx");

// Initialize the presentation

Presentation presentation = new Presentation();

ISlide slide = presentation.Slides[0];

// Convert each worksheet to an image and add it to the presentation

foreach (Worksheet sheet in workbook.Worksheets)

{

ImageOrPrintOptions options = new ImageOrPrintOptions()

{

OnePagePerSheet = true,

ImageFormat = ImageFormat.Png

};

SheetRender sr = new SheetRender(sheet, options);

for (int i = 0; i < sr.PageCount; i++)

{

using (MemoryStream imageStream = new MemoryStream())

{

sr.ToImage(i, imageStream);

imageStream.Position = 0;

IPPImage image = presentation.Images.AddImage(imageStream);

slide.Shapes.AddPictureFrame(ShapeType.Rectangle, 0, 0, presentation.SlideSize.Size.Width, presentation.SlideSize.Size.Height, image);

}

}

}

// Save the presentation

presentation.Save("output.pptx", SaveFormat.Pptx);

2. SlideModel

SlideModel是一个在线平台,提供了大量Excel到PPT的模板和工具。用户可以上传Excel文件,选择适当的模板,自动生成PPT文件。

七、技巧和注意事项

1. 保持数据格式

在将Excel内容复制到PPT时,确保数据格式和样式保持一致。可以通过选择适当的粘贴选项和使用样式模板来实现。

2. 动态更新数据

如果需要保持数据实时更新,可以使用链接或宏来实现。确保链接和宏设置正确,并定期更新数据。

3. 优化图片质量

如果将Excel内容导出为图片,确保图片质量足够高,以便在PPT中清晰显示。可以调整分辨率和图像格式,选择合适的保存选项。

4. 使用适当的工具

根据具体需求选择合适的方法和工具。如果需要大量数据转换,可以考虑使用第三方工具或宏来自动化过程。

八、总结

将Excel内容转换为PPT是一个常见的需求,可以通过多种方法实现。直接复制粘贴、使用链接、导出为图片、使用Excel内置功能、利用宏和第三方工具都是有效的方法。根据具体需求选择合适的方法,并注意保持数据格式、动态更新数据和优化图片质量。通过合理选择和使用这些方法,可以高效地将Excel内容转换为PPT,并在演示中清晰展示数据。

相关问答FAQs:

1.如何将Excel中的数据转换成PPT幻灯片?

将Excel表格转换为PPT幻灯片是一种有效的方式,使得您的数据更加直观和易于理解。以下是一些简单的步骤来帮助您完成这一转换:

  • 在Excel中选择您想要转换的数据,并复制它们到剪贴板。
  • 打开PowerPoint并选择您想要插入表格的幻灯片。
  • 在幻灯片中,选择“粘贴”选项,并选择“保留源格式”或“使用目标主题”。
  • 调整表格的大小和位置以适应幻灯片布局。
  • 根据需要进行任何其他的格式调整,如添加图表、调整颜色和字体等。

2.如何在PPT中插入Excel图表?

将Excel图表插入PPT幻灯片可以使得数据更加生动和易于理解。以下是一些简单的步骤来帮助您完成这一操作:

  • 在Excel中创建并编辑您想要插入的图表。
  • 在Excel中选择图表,并复制它到剪贴板。
  • 打开PowerPoint并选择您想要插入图表的幻灯片。
  • 在幻灯片中,选择“粘贴”选项,并选择“保留源格式”或“使用目标主题”。
  • 调整图表的大小和位置以适应幻灯片布局。
  • 根据需要进行任何其他的格式调整,如添加标签、调整颜色和字体等。

3.如何在PPT中嵌入Excel工作表?

将Excel工作表嵌入到PPT幻灯片中可以使得数据更加直观和易于查看。以下是一些简单的步骤来帮助您完成这一操作:

  • 在Excel中选择您想要嵌入的工作表,并复制它到剪贴板。
  • 打开PowerPoint并选择您想要嵌入工作表的幻灯片。
  • 在幻灯片中,选择“粘贴”选项,并选择“嵌入Excel工作表”。
  • 调整工作表的大小和位置以适应幻灯片布局。
  • 根据需要进行任何其他的格式调整,如添加标题、调整颜色和字体等。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4590338

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部